作者: Biofeedback    時(shí)間: 2025-3-28 12:43
On the Riemann’s Problem for One Nonstrictly Hyperbolic SystemWe consider the Riemann’s problem for the multicomponent Euler system. In this paper, we describe possible types of shockwave and rarefaction wave bifurcations near the critical manifold.

A Generalized Cahn-Hilliard Equation with Logarithmic PotentialsOur aim in this paper is to study the well-posedness for a generalized Cahn-Hilliard equation with a proliferation term and singular potentials. We also prove the existence of the global attractor.
